Hi all,

I just picked up a 2019 RAM 2500 Limited and I cannot identify how to stop the blower level from dropping everytime the system dictates a text or I engage the phone /NAV via speaking to the system. How do i stop this? I have spent much time in settings and surfing the web but no luck.

Thanks

The blower lowers so that the microphones don't pick up the noise, and so that you can hear the dictated text easier. There's nothing to be done about it, it's programmed in.
